ANTHONY PUJOL

Painter/Photographer/Graphic Designer

 

 

“I take a lot of inspiration from my dad; a man who had suffered a stroke back in 2007, being physically impaired on his right side of his body, to then being told two years later that he had been diagnose with thyroid cancer. Reflecting on those years, seeing someone adjusted to a role where they can no longer do the things they use to be able to do and submitting to the idea that they are more vulnerable to the world.

Watching him through his recovery and seeing the person that he is today, he now is someone who is more humble and meek that through family and faith you can overcome those difficulties, hardships and become a better person from it.

 

 

“In life it is strange to think when people say that sometimes you need to be broken in order to be fixed...my dad is just one of many examples of that.

 

 

Anthony Pujol's current series of work entitled 'You have to be broken in order to be fixed' looks into the aftermath of his father's recovery as he observes, reflects and photographs an interment view of his daily life.
